Juan Martin Diaz will try to give a boost to the development of padel in Chile. We no longer present him, he is a gentleman from padel. More than 10 years world number 1 alongside Fernando Belasteguin, Juan Martin Diaz (JMD) is an icon of padel in Europe and also and especially in Latin America since he is of Argentine origin.

One of his neighbors needs a boost and what's more fun than giving him.

Chile, a beautiful country in South America, took a long time to come to terms with padel. But there it is. Recently a federation has emerged, and like everywhere, this sport has more followers every day.

In order to develop it more quickly and especially to make investors more interested in it, several demonstrations have been made with great players like Lamperti, Mieres or JMD.
